Top models, including Crystal Renn and Marquita Pring, have triggered huge debate around body size in the modelling world of late.

Recently, Pring told fashionista.com why she thinks everyone is so fixated by size issues: “Because not only is it a more attainable image but it’s finally something different!” she explained.

“We’ve been manipulated by the media and fashion industry to believe that there is only one body type: super skinny. The majority of people in this world will never be as thin as they’ve been warped into believing they need to be.”

Renn, who is currently starring in Chanel’s newest campaign, told Fashionista: “I think the fashion industry is changing and is more open to a new ideal.

“It’s about a personality and a moment captured…it’s not about body size it’s about talent and effort…I hope the industry sees this [Chanel campaign] as an example of that.”

Pring said of Renn: “Crystal’s been promoting a message that is so positive and beneficial to our society: health. It doesn’t matter what size you are, just be healthy. You can be a size 2 and be far less healthy than a person that is a size 14. There is no right or wrong size if you’re healthy and fit.”
